Redbridge Network Group

Launched in September 2009 as the Ilford Network Group was the second such group initiated by the South West Essex FSB Branch.

 

It changed venue and name in February 2011 to became the Redbridge Network Group.

 

The group meets on alternate Fridays from 7.45am until 9.30am

redbridge college logoVenue

The Ilford Network Group meets at Redbridge College, Barley Lane, Little Heath, Romford, RM6 4XT

 

 

Meeting Organisation

There is free car parking on site.

 

The Ilford Network Group coordinator is Stephen King of Valleyside Cars.
